K9 Toney is an 8-year-old Belgian Malinois certified in Tracking/Trailing, Narcotics, and Article Search. She is assigned to Lieutenant Don Johnson of the East Palestine OH Police Department. Toney has taken thousands of dollars worth of illegal drugs from the streets of East Palestine and throughout Columbiana County OH. K9 Toney absolutely loves working and, in her spare time, enjoys hanging out at home, chewing on her bone collection and helping rid the yard of sticks.

Here’s how this equipment grant would help Toney and Lt. Johnson on the job:

The Ranger K9 Trauma Kit provides sterile, veterinary grade, K9-specific supplies to assist an officer in providing aid to their K9 in the event of an on-the-job incident or injury. This kit includes a canine oxygen mask, along with other first aid items, a quick reference sheet for K9 vitals and dosing, and comes in a heavy-duty, canvas bag that is embroidered with emblems ensuring that it is easily identifiable for K9 use.
